		<description>My latest post is a guest post by a reader.  I noticed this reader left a particularly insightful comment and this made me so happy I sent him a personal email.  Basically I thanked him for his contribution in enlarging the points I raised on the post.  And then I asked him to flesh out some parts so it would read nicely as a guest post.  The very next day he emailed the same comments with additional paragraphs as requested.  He&#039;s happy he&#039;s able to build upon where I left off.  Thus, I have my first guest post.  Well,  I&#039;m pleased I have gained a reader who&#039;s enthusiastic in keeping the conversation going in my blog.

So in the next days, I&#039;m looking into your other suggestions in co-opting readers into active participants in my blog.  You&#039;ve been of great help to me.  Thanks. :)</description>

		<description>I made my blog comments dofollow and added the top commentators plugin. I&#039;m also giving a free ad spot to my top commentator of the month. For all of this I increase my comments up to 300% in February, comparing to January.</description>
